JOE ALVEREZ PEREZ, SR.
MAY 15, 1929 - APRIL 3, 2012
Joe Alverez Perez Sr., 82 years of age, passed away   April 3rd at home surrounded by family.  He was born in Tuolumne, Calif. on May 15, 1929.  In 1937, he along with his family moved to the Merced area (father, Jesse Cavral Perez; mother, Ruperta Griego Alverez; brothers John and Alfred (Daniel); sisters Jessie and Esther).  He attended Galen Clark School in Merced.  At 17 years of age he started working for the Southern Pacific Railroad.  While working for the railroad he met the love of his life, Leonila (Nita) Sosa Galindo. They married Sept. 9, 1947.  He became a tile setter by learning the trade from Walt Norton.  In 1963, he and Nita along with his older brother, John and his wife Phyllis opened Tequila Café in Winton.  In 1965 through hard work and perseverance, he opened his own tile business, Atwater Tile and with Nita opened the Mexican restaurant La Nita's Café, all the while raising 5 sons. Joe was never one to be idle.  He was not only productive and industrious in business but also the various service organizations he was a member of (Free and Accepted Masons, Livingston-Hills Ferry Lodge #236, PM 1977 & 1979 and Mariposa Lodge #24, PM 2001; Fresno Scottish Rite; Tri County Scottish Rite in Merced; San Joaquin Valley Shriners; Merced/Mariposa Shrine Club, Pres. 1994; Shrine Arabians Unit; Livingston Chapter #531 OES, PWP 1985).  Joe was preceded in death by his parents, grandchild, Matthew, brother, John and his beloved wife of 64 yrs, Nita.  He is survived by his five sons, Joe Jr. (Rosie), Rudy (Debbie), Bob (Amy), Ricky (Lynn), Gabe (Michele), 12 grandchildren and 14 great grandchildren. Joe will forever be remembered for many reasons and one being his beautiful singing voice.  Whenever he was at an event that had mariachis, he had the ability to get up and lead the group into many traditional Mexican songs, his voice sounding even better than the "professionals".  God bless you Dad, until we meet again.     Friends and family are invited to remember and celebrate the life of Joe Alverez Perez.  Visitation will be on Thursday, Apr. 12th from 4-8pm (wake service 7pm) at Wilson Family Funeral Chapel, 1290 Winton Way, Atwater.  Funeral service will take place on Friday, Apr. 13th 10am at Evergreen Christian Center, 5935 N. Winton Way, Winton.  Burial will follow at Winton Cemetery.
